Climate & Weather

Kalachinsk has a cool climate with an average annual temperature of 34°F. Winters average 1°F in January while summers reach 67°F in July. With 311 sunny days per year, residents enjoy well above the national average of sunshine. Annual precipitation totals 13.9 inches. Air quality is rated Good with a median AQI of 34.
